Are you ready to take your GED® exam in Floyd VA? The examination is only given in pencil and paper format. Typically in order to sit for the test the test taker must be older than 17 years old. The testing cost in the state of Virginia typically varies from $40 to $90.
The test covers five topics: reading, writing, math, science and social studies. Each part of the test gives a score between 200-800. Most states require students to receive a score of 410 on each of the five sections and an overall average of 450 for the GED® test to pass.
